  • sorry ! Wes (john wesley) is a guitarist, songwriter, singer from USA (Florida, tampa I think). as solo artist he recorded more than 2albums (exactly 5 :

    Under the Red and White Sky 1994,

    The Closing of the Pale Blue Eyes 1995,

    The Emperor Falls 1998,Chasing Monsters 2002,

    Shiver 2005) and many live recordings.

    He joined Porcupine Tree for the In Absentia tour, Then became 5th man of the band !

    on Deadwing and Fear of a blank planet he plays guitar, sing vocals

    he's complementary to SW
